Haydon School offers careers information, advice and guidance service for 12- 19-year-olds. This means that all students in years 8-13 can get information, guidance and advice to help them make important decisions and choices.

Indie Nizzar is the Careers Adviser at Haydon School and is in three days a week

Tuesday, Wednesday and Thursday
St Mary’s building (Library)

Students can get support on courses & qualifications, employment, apprenticeships & training, higher education, careers, leisure time and more.

This is done through;

  • One2One Guidance appointments
  • Attendance at some parents evenings, options evenings and HE evening
  • Student drop in’s
  • Assemblies
  • Group work sessions
  • Careers Event
  • Up-to-date resources on Fronter
